T-Mobile Announces Internet TV Service Coming in 2018
T-Mobile today announced that it will launch its own over-the-top TV service in 2018, which will be fueled in part through the acquisition of Layer3 TV. Details about the service are scarce, but T-Mobile CEO John Legere said that it will continue the company’s theme of being a “disruptive” solution to its rivals, this time in both the internet TV and paid cable markets.
